  • Patent number: 7381032
    Abstract: In a hermetic compressor in a freezing refrigerating system or an air-conditioning system such as a refrigerator or a showcase, a construction is disclosed for intending to provide a low-noise hermetic compressor by effectively attenuating a pressure pulsation having occurred in a compression chamber with a suction muffler. By this construction, since a muffler cover 20 has a planar simple shape, the deformation upon molding becomes little and it can come into fully close contact with a muffler main body 19. Therefore, the pressure pulsation hardly leaks through the connecting portion between the muffler main body 19 and the muffler cover 20. The full silencing effect that the suction muffler 18 has is obtained and thereby noise can be reduced more effectively.

  • Patent number: 6206655
    Abstract: An electrically-operated sealed compressor includes a cylinder, a cylinder head mounted on the cylinder and having a suction chamber and first and second discharge chambers, a piston accommodated in the cylinder, and a valve mechanism. The valve mechanism includes a suction muffler and a valve plate having at least one suction port, first and second discharge ports, and first and second pass holes. The first discharge port and the first pass hole communicate with the first discharge chamber, while the second discharge port and the second pass hole communicate with the second discharge chamber. The valve mechanism also includes first and second discharge valves mounted on the valve plate and accommodated in the first and second discharge chambers, respectively, a suction reed having a reed valve for selectively opening and closing the suction port, a discharge gasket for sealing the valve plate and the cylinder head, and a discharge muffler.
